Output 08cdd07e571a01b85bcc05cf1ee1648e4d8896237e01f2afa42d49a0bc175884:6

value
43300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c623db303b14559a95503a258655ce21b3f37f4 OP_EQUAL
address
3LKhTajRobBboBMSL86g66hLxYFGpBVkRH
transaction
08cdd07e571a01b85bcc05cf1ee1648e4d8896237e01f2afa42d49a0bc175884
spent
true